الملخص الإنجليزي

This research aims to conducting evaluations for the influence of side collapse of excavations on the estimated cost and time for a proposed project.

The methodology applied in this research is to comprise several phases.

The first phase focused on identifying factors, methods, and previous studies concerning the side collapse of excavations for construction projects.

However, this phase included site visits to several construction projects with a focus to a selected case study in Amman.

the second phase focused on designing a survey questionnaire regarding attitudes for the major factors affecting the side collapse of excavations in Jordan and their accompanies with the time and cost of carrying out the intended project, and then distributing this questionnaire to several engineers and experts working in the field of construction.

The next phase for the research methodology was the analysis of the collected data (resulted from the distributed questionnaire) using SPSS program.

Finally, the last phase of this research was concentrated on developing guidelines and preparing conclusions and recommendations.

Based on the analysis of the field survey, the results indicated that there are various factors that affecting the side collapse of excavations for construction projects.

It was concluded that the most important factor was the weather conditions and other surrounding conductions, in addition to Planning and following-up the methods used to protect commercial project excavations from collapse.

Among other parameters, the lack of interest to plan for the time needed to conduct the required investigation is one of the significant results.

Also lack of supplies for the project site prior to implementation (with emphasis on commercial building sites), facilitating the passage of workers and excavations to the project, and securing the side traffic at the project, as verified by the case study Accordingly, it is recommended that project managers before the implementation of the project shall investigate the methods to prepare the project before the start, in order to prevent the collapse of the side of the excavations for the construction projects, and the importance of working schedules required for all phases of the project so that no increase in the time and cost required to establish the project on the required quality.
